The OPERA neutrino oscillation experiment is based on the use of the Emulsion Cloud Chamber (ECC). In the OPERA ECC, nuclear emulsion films acting as very high precision tracking detectors are interleaved with lead plates providing a massive target for neutrino interactions. Agarose emulsion droplet microfluidic technology for single copy emulsion PCR (ePCR) is a suitable technique for the detection of single copy DNA molecules. It improves the traditional ePCR by employing agarose with low melting and low gelling temperatures, which is coupled with PCR forward primers using Schiff-base reaction. We introduce a novel approach for synthesizing mesoporous hydroxyapatite (HAp, (Ca)10, (PO4)6(OH)2) using double emulsion droplets as microreactors. By using capillary microfluidic techniques, the size and the geometry of the droplet microreactors can be tuned easily.
